Pros

- Flexible working hours (depending on the LM) - Possibility to work from home (depending on the LM) - Payroll is never late

Cons

- Company re-hires employees that left the company few months ago with high salaries while gives 1-2% raise to current employees and high performers. It is suggested that you leave Nokia & come back after 6-8 months. Only then you will get higher salary and respect. - There is no reward of any kind - it is pointless to go the extra mile or support the company beyond your job description - There are many unsuitable Line Managers doing damage to peoples/teams. There is no poor performer plan for them - They will be LMs until retirement. - Upper management is not in place to take actions to fix real issues. Problems are know but trying to hide them under the carpet. - It is impossible to get a position since all positions are already assigned to someone before the go live to Internal Job Market.
